Output 896359923145b72532bc3fe07d0a7edde09be9794680c13de35d18617430d0da:0

value
125265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a646b99d96e7c90a604a4f50b830180055edfda OP_EQUAL
address
3HDy6UqjwefsWjbioqnB2YGJLDnVXWRchD
transaction
896359923145b72532bc3fe07d0a7edde09be9794680c13de35d18617430d0da
spent
true